The symptoms seem to be all closely related, so I'm putting them together: - on desktop, when the window height is reduced, the second scrollbar appears. (attached screenshot) - on iOS 10 Safari, scrolling BMO became choppy and lost the "momentum" effect - on iOS 10 Safari, the "scroll to top" shortcut (triggered by tapping the top bar) no longer works.
